Abstract
SOBSS is architecture of OBSS (object-based storage system) proposed from time, data trans-mission and security aspects by which performance of OBSS can be promoted effectively. In this paper, a security mechanism for OBSS called as NSM is proposed. The prominent feature of NSM is that a security model adopted in our architecture of SOBSS which is different from traditional security model. In NSM, clients request for only once, and then receive both data and credential necessary for next request process. The working principle of NSM is also discussed in our paper. NSM security mechanism in our architecture of SOBSS provides a scheme for simplifying security model in OBSS.
